A man has pleaded not guilty to a number of charges relating to an incident where a teenager was stabbed and another suffered injuries at a McDonald's in Ealing .

Gerardo Buci, of no fixed address, pleaded not guilty to GBH with intent, ABH and possession of an offensive weapon at Isleworth Crown Court on December 2.

The 18-year-old will appear for trial at the same court on April 3 next year.

He had been charged on November 3 after two boys were found injured by Metropolitan Police officers at McDonald's in The Broadway on October 31, following reports of a stabbing.

One of the boys, who was aged 14, suffered stab wounds and was taken to hospital with non life threatening injuries.

A 16-year-old boy had suffered a minor cut to the head, but he was not taken to hospital.

No further arrests have made in relation to the incident.
